Overview
The LTC1403HMSE#PBF is a high-performance analog-to-digital converter (ADC) produced by Analog Devices Inc. This 12-bit ADC is designed for applications requiring high speed and precision. It operates at a sampling rate of 2.8 million samples per second (MSPS) and features a successive approximation register (SAR) architecture. The device is packaged in a 10-MSOP-EP (Micro Small Outline Package with Exposed Pad), making it suitable for space-constrained designs.
Key Specifications
Parameter | Value |
---|---|
Number of Bits | 12 |
Sampling Rate | 2.8 MSPS |
Input Type | Differential, Single Ended |
Supply Voltage (Digital) | 2.7 V ~ 3.6 V |
Supply Voltage (Analog) | 2.7 V ~ 3.6 V |
Package | 10-MSOP-EP |
Operating Temperature | -40°C ~ 125°C |
Moisture Sensitivity Level (MSL) | 1 (Unlimited) |
Lead Free Status / RoHS Status | Lead free / RoHS Compliant |
